Great fun January 6, 2009 Our 13 month old loves this Busy Ball Popper. It does a great job teaching cause and effect. ( not to mention a lot of fun for babies and adults playing with them) It is a lot of laughs watching his face while playing with this toy. One down side is that many other toys come with balls heavier in weight which don't pop out (I hide the other balls when he is playing with this toy) good purchase!

Annoying for parents, fun for kids January 5, 2009 My son got this toy when he was 10 months old. He absolutely loves it. My problems with it are that sometimes the balls don't pop up at all or they fly out too forcefully and go across the room. Sometimes he likes to push the plunger on it just to feel the air blowing from the pop out part.
